Curling at the 2010 Winter Olympics was held between 16 and 27 February 2010 at the Vancouver Olympic Centre.

Statistics[]

  • There were 93 total athletes from 12 countries.
  • Stella Heiss was the youngest participant, with 17 years and 33 days.
  • Ulrik Schmidt was the oldest participant, with 47 years and 181 days.
  • Canada won 2 medals in this event, more than any other nation.
